After the removal of perm solution, relaxer, bleach, or aniline tints, hair is in what state: -
Answer-alkaline, base
The best way to be certain how a color will appear on a clients hair, is to conduct a / an:
- Answer-Strand test
The best way to determine how a client's hair, skin, or nails will react to a certain
product is to conduct, any or all of the following except: - Answer-Allergy Test
If the client's skin becomes inflamed after a Patch Test is given, this result is said to be:
- Answer-Positive
If a positive result is observed, including inflamed skin, this is a condition known as: -
Answer-Dermatitis venenata
The application of a virgin tint going lighter, should begin: - Answer-Where the hair is
the darkest
This act / law requires a P.D. Test prior to the application of aniline derivative tints: -
Answer-U.S. Federal Food, Drug, and Cosmetic Act
Which governmental agency mandates the use of a P.D. Test prior to using aniline tints:
- Answer-FDA
An example of a progressive hair dye is: - Answer-Metallic dyes
____________ leave the hair unfit for further chemical services: - Answer-Metallic dyes
Certified colors are: - Answer-Temporary products
The application of a virgin tint going darker, should begin: - Answer-Where the hair is
the lightest
If your client has almost entirely gray hair and wants to darken it to its original color,
where should you begin to apply the product? - Answer-Front
The simplest way to correct a greenish cast in blonde hair would be with: - Answer-Red
, The terms, ash, smoky, and drab are used interchangeably and regard what color
base/s? - Answer-Green, blue, or violet
Henna is an example of what type of tint? - Answer-Vegetable
Aniline derivative tints may safely be applied if the P.D. test was: - Answer-Negative and
between 24 & 48 hours old
A compound dye, is generally made by combining metallic salts with: - Answer-
Vegetable dyes
Aniline derivative tints are also known as: - Answer-Penetrating dyes
A yellowish cast in hair could be camouflaged by using a: - Answer-Bluing rinse
A synthetic organic compound derived from coal tar used to give color to hair dye: -
Answer-Para-phenylene-diamine
Certified colors are most often found in: - Answer-temporary colors, color rinses or
mousse
Aniline derivative tints are also known as: - Answer-Oxidative tints
Builds up and coats the cuticle, with repeated applications makes the hair darker: -
Answer-Progressive dye / tint
What is the action of a semi or demi-permanent color on the hair? - Answer-Deposit
pigment
What is the action of an aniline derivative tint color (w/ appropriate H2O2) on the hair? -
Answer-Lift and deposit pigment
What is the action of a high lift color (w/ appropriate developer) on the hair? - Answer-
Lift and deposit pigment
What is the action of a bleach (w/ appropriate developer) on the hair? - Answer-Lift
natural pigment
Which of the following choices correctly identifies the 3 primary colors? - Answer-Red,
Yellow & Blue
A client has lightened his / her hair to an odd shade of orange. They are unhappy with it.
What color should you use to tone the orange from the hair? - Answer-Blue
A client's hair is 70% - 80% gray and wants it tinted to its original color. Choose: -
Answer-One shade darker than original color
